1. Manufacturing Capabilities
The manufacturing capabilities of aerospace firms located in Brea, California, are foundational to their operations and directly reflect their contributions to the broader aerospace industry. These capabilities determine the type and complexity of products they can produce, impacting their competitiveness and role within the supply chain.
- Precision Machining
A core competence within many of these companies involves precision machining. This includes Computer Numerical Control (CNC) milling, turning, and grinding processes capable of producing parts with extremely tight tolerances. These components are often critical for engine parts, structural elements, and hydraulic systems where minute deviations can compromise performance and safety. An example is the manufacture of turbine blades, which require intricate geometries and high surface finishes achievable only through advanced machining techniques.
- Materials Processing
Aerospace manufacturing often involves specialized materials processing techniques. Companies in Brea may possess capabilities in heat treating, surface coating, and non-destructive testing. These processes are essential for ensuring the durability, corrosion resistance, and structural integrity of aerospace components. For instance, anodizing aluminum alloys for aircraft skins or applying thermal barrier coatings to engine components are common practices that extend the lifespan and improve the performance of these parts.
- Composites Manufacturing
The use of composite materials is increasingly prevalent in the aerospace sector due to their high strength-to-weight ratios. Firms located in Brea may specialize in the fabrication of composite structures using techniques such as resin transfer molding (RTM), automated fiber placement (AFP), and hand lay-up. These materials are employed in aircraft wings, fuselage sections, and interior components, offering significant weight savings compared to traditional metals. An example is the manufacturing of carbon fiber reinforced polymer (CFRP) control surfaces for unmanned aerial vehicles (UAVs).
- Assembly and Integration
Beyond component manufacturing, some aerospace companies in Brea offer assembly and integration services. This entails assembling individual parts into larger sub-assemblies or complete systems, often involving electrical wiring, hydraulic connections, and mechanical fastening. This capability is crucial for delivering turn-key solutions to aerospace customers. Examples include the assembly of avionics systems or the integration of propulsion components into engine modules.

3. Regulatory Compliance
Regulatory compliance is a critical aspect of operations for organizations involved in aerospace activities in Brea, California. Adherence to stringent standards and guidelines established by regulatory bodies is not merely a procedural requirement, but a fundamental necessity for ensuring safety, reliability, and legal operation within this highly regulated sector.
- FAA Regulations (Federal Aviation Administration)
Compliance with FAA regulations is paramount for any company involved in the design, manufacturing, or maintenance of aircraft or aircraft components. These regulations cover a wide range of activities, including airworthiness certification, manufacturing processes, and quality control systems. Failure to comply can result in significant penalties, including fines, production shutdowns, or revocation of operating licenses. An example includes compliance with Part 21 of the FAA regulations, which outlines the requirements for obtaining a Production Certificate, allowing a company to manufacture aircraft parts. For companies in Brea, strict adherence to these rules is essential for participation in the broader aerospace supply chain.
- AS9100 Certification
AS9100 is a widely adopted quality management system standard specifically designed for the aerospace industry. Achieving and maintaining AS9100 certification demonstrates a commitment to meeting the rigorous quality requirements of the sector. The standard encompasses all aspects of an organization’s operations, from design and development to manufacturing and delivery. For aerospace companies in Brea, AS9100 certification can be a competitive advantage, as it signals to customers and partners that the company operates according to internationally recognized best practices. It can also facilitate entry into certain markets or contracts that require this certification. For example, many prime aerospace contractors require their suppliers to be AS9100 certified.
- ITAR Compliance (International Traffic in Arms Regulations)
ITAR governs the export and import of defense-related articles and services. Aerospace companies in Brea that handle sensitive technologies or components subject to ITAR restrictions must comply with these regulations. This includes obtaining export licenses, implementing security measures to prevent unauthorized access to controlled information, and conducting regular audits to ensure compliance. Violations of ITAR can result in severe criminal and civil penalties. Companies in Brea supplying components for military aircraft or defense systems are particularly affected and must maintain robust ITAR compliance programs.
- Environmental Regulations
Aerospace manufacturing processes can generate hazardous waste and emissions that are subject to environmental regulations at the federal, state, and local levels. Compliance with these regulations requires implementing appropriate waste management practices, controlling air and water emissions, and obtaining necessary permits. Companies in Brea must adhere to regulations established by agencies like the EPA (Environmental Protection Agency) and the California Environmental Protection Agency (CalEPA). Failure to comply can result in fines, remediation orders, and reputational damage. For example, proper disposal of solvents used in cleaning and painting operations is a critical aspect of environmental compliance.
